Early-stage tech startups (Seed to Series A stage) often begin their sales journey by finding design partners and beta clients through introductions from investors, advisors, consultants, and the hard work of the founding team. At this stage, founders can excel at sales due to their passion for the solution, driving them to establish product/market fit and attract significant investor interest. However, scaling these efforts isn't straightforward, especially as founders usually come from technical backgrounds, particularly evident in the Israeli startup ecosystem. Despite this, being able to scale whatever sales motion that is developed is imperative.
The next step typically involves hiring sales talent. However, a common mistake is for founders to hire an account executive managed by the CEO, effectively turning the CEO into a de facto VP of Sales, a role they might not excel in. Apart from managing the sales executive, they might not want to delve into setting up critical tech stack tools crucial for modern sales operations. These tools not only scale sales activities but also gather invaluable data to refine sales processes and inform a robust Go-To-Market strategy, laying the groundwork for growth.
Here's a dive into the essential tools you need to establish your sales operations foundation:
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Platform:
A robust CRM platform lies at the core of any sales tech stack. It's crucial to avoid new entrants in this space unless you've extensively researched them, as getting the CRM wrong can be costly, with switching pain adding to the mistake's severity.
This tool acts as a central hub for managing customer interactions, tracking leads and opportunities, and streamlining the sales pipeline. In the early stages, you can also leverage it for client success and support. While there are numerous features and capabilities, it's advisable to stick with established options like Salesforce.com or HubSpot Sales Hub unless you have expertise in another solution.
Sales Intelligence Tools:
To gain a competitive edge, leverage sales intelligence tools offering insights into your target audience, industry trends, and competitor activities. These tools help identify high-potential leads, personalize sales pitches, and make data-driven decisions to optimize sales strategies.
Consider tools like Lusha or ZoomInfo for enriching lead data and Gong.io for collecting insights on sales team conversations with prospects and clients.

Marketing Automation Software:
Integrating marketing automation software improves lead generation and nurturing efforts. Automate tasks like email campaigns, lead scoring, and follow-up sequences to free up your sales team's time for high-value activities like closing deals.
Platforms like HubSpot Marketing Hub and Marketo Engage by Adobe offer robust automation features for enhancing marketing efforts.
Communication & Collaboration Tools:
Effective communication and collaboration are vital for successful sales teams. Invest in tools like Zoom for video conferencing, Slack for real-time communication and project collaboration, and Monday.com for centralizing team collaboration and project management.
Analytics and Reporting Tools:
Implement analytics and reporting tools for data-driven decision-making. PowerBI or Tableau are powerful tools for creating interactive dashboards and reports, while Google Analytics provides insights into website visitor behavior for lead capture optimization.
While these are some of the most essential tools, additional technologies like Outreach.io, SalesLoft, Rightbound, LeadLeaper, Hunter.io, and Cultivated Culture's Mailscoop can be valuable additions, especially in the early stages of sales operations.
Remember, the right tech stack sets the stage for scalable sales operations and lays the groundwork for future growth.
